Output 26c95af77268df756c6034fc1dc4c24b1eb0416f77da92d8b72db5f2c7aa7639:1

value
51983000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e7aed0fa49f4d62368e68c7ad0c0d9fc27d56e OP_EQUAL
address
MLHkzwE6zQHxyFba3kdW1jtXe32BZEPfrC
transaction
26c95af77268df756c6034fc1dc4c24b1eb0416f77da92d8b72db5f2c7aa7639
spent
true